The news, drawn from CBC reporting, notes that large swaths of forest burned by wildfires have generated plumes that drift long distances. Experts say the general pattern of smoke movement this summer is not extraordinary, but the scale and intensity of fires are contributing to worsening air quality over multiple regions.
Observers have observed smoke entering into eastern North America despite the distance from the original fire zones. As the particles travel, they can tint skies with orange or gray hues and reduce visibility in affected cities. Public health agencies in some locations have issued air quality warnings to inform residents about potential respiratory impacts, particularly for vulnerable groups.

Analysts emphasize that while this year’s smoke behavior follows existing meteorological and atmospheric transport patterns, the underlying trend of increasing wildfire activity due to climate conditions suggests that such events may become more common or intense in the future.
Officials recommend standard protective measures during smoky conditions: limiting outdoor exertion when air quality is poor, staying indoors with filtered air when possible, and following local advisories for air quality indices. Individuals with asthma, bronchitis, or other respiratory conditions are advised to monitor symptoms and seek medical guidance as needed.
